Calculate Log Base 90 of 40

To solve the equation log 90 (40)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 40, a = 90:
    log 90 (40) = log(40) / log(90)
  3. Evaluate the term:
    log(40) / log(90)
    = 1.39794000867204 / 1.92427928606188
    = 0.81978566303299
    = Logarithm of 40 with base 90
